Output 51a230086a1aa1e531ceb3571fafe9d7ca7a515ea48b4adcaafd1c007641215f:6

value
9510
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5c77860a7c499fbce73ea96a6c9238f0ebad3877361bd74617861628dd744ea8
address
bc1pt3mcvznufx0meee7494xey3c7r466wrhxcdaw3shsctz3ht5f65qxfm2cg
transaction
51a230086a1aa1e531ceb3571fafe9d7ca7a515ea48b4adcaafd1c007641215f
spent
true